: Kodak leans heavily into his singing voice rather than traditional rapping. While critics from Pitchfork and The Red & Black noted that his singing can occasionally fall flat or feel "grating," many fans appreciate the raw, unrefined emotion it brings to the song. “Kodak's ability to flow almost effortlessly over a
Produced by and Leland , the track features a smooth, laid-back instrumental that complements Kodak's vulnerable delivery. Lyrically, Kodak expresses a desire for space, not necessarily a permanent breakup, while his partner's insecurities—fueled by rumors and his demanding studio schedule—begin to take a toll.
